Nettet11. feb. 2011 · First of all, you want the vent run to be the shortest you can. Every 90 degree turn adds five effective feet to the length of the run. So if the duct starts with a 90 at the wall, goes up 8 feet, has a 90 and goes 10 feet and another 90, you have an effective length of 33 feet. Depending on your dryer, this may be too long of a run. Nettet31. jul. 2008 · There are no code requirements for clearance to dryer vents, but I'd certainly recommend leaving some air space around that vent. They get very hot, and can present a fire hazard if lint builds up. Insulating around the vent will promote even more heat buildup. If you must insulate it, use fiberglass with no paper face. buletbob

Nettet22. feb. 2024 · Check the Duct Lengths. Longer dryer ducts means more resistance to airflow, and most dryer manufacturers call for a total length of 35 ft. or less (check the owner’s manual). But remember this: Each 90-degree elbow counts as 5 ft. So if you need two elbows, for example, the rest of the duct can total only 25 ft. Nettet2. A good solution would be to make a collar/cover of a material that would fit visually with the outside wall, and would provide a reliable seal to prevent water, air, and pest infiltration. Then to support a good seal, use spray foam to insulate around the duct. The appropriate material for the collar depends on the wall you're going through.
